On 2007-04-24 11:18 +0100, Carsten Dominik wrote:
LEVEL=2/-DONE means that the search for stuck projects should
consider
any level 2 entry (i.e. starting with **) as a project, but should
immediately exclude projects where the top headline is marked DONE.

I remember we had a discussion to make LEVEL=2 respect
`org-odd-levels-only' i.e. LEVEL=2 would mean headings starting with
three "*" when org-odd-levels-only is t.
